Non-invasive lobular neoplasia (LN) encompasses atypical lobular hyperplasia (ALH), classic lobular carcinoma in situ (CLCIS), florid lobular carcinoma in situ (FLCIS), and pleomorphic lobular carcinoma in situ (PLCIS). Lobular neoplasia is a neoplastic epithelial proliferation of the terminal duct lobular unit. A defining feature is discohesion due to the loss of E-cadherin, a protein that facilitates cell-to-cell adhesion.

Obstructive sleep apnea hypopnea syndrome (OSAHS) is a common sleep-disordered breathing condition that exhibits a notable degree of heterogeneity, a feature not fully considered in current diagnostic and therapeutic strategies. This article reviews and analyzes research progress in the subtyping of OSAHS from multiple perspectives, including clinical feature-based subtyping, comorbidity-based subtyping, polysomnography (PSG) parameter-based subtyping, and other classification approaches. Existing studies have identified common subtypes based on clinical features and clarified the characteristics of different subgroups in comorbidity-based classifications; the rich data provided by PSG have helped optimize the classification of OSAHS; and multi-dimensional clustering has provided a more precise basis for individualized treatment.

In-transit metastases (ITM) are estimated to occur in 5-10% of primary cutaneous melanomas. They are classified as stage III disease in the American Joint Committee on Cancer classification system and are associated with approximately a 30% 10-year survival rate. The management of ITM is not standardized.
